Modern engineering dictates that sunrooms must transition from simple frame shelters to high-efficiency building envelope structures. Our design and technical teams have engineered a comprehensive solutions roadmap covering profile optimization, thermal management, drainage efficiency, and security integration.
| System Module | Technical Feature | Engineering Specification | Compliance Standards |
|---|---|---|---|
| Primary Frame | T66 Grade Structural Aluminum Alloy (6063-T66) | Wall thickness ≥ 3.0mm; Tensile Strength ≥ 205 MPa | GB/T 5237 / ASTM B221 |
| Thermal Isolators | Multi-cavity Polyamide Insulating Strips (PA66-GF25) | Width: 24mm to 39mm options; Thermal Conductivity ≤ 0.3 W/(m·K) | EN 14024 / ASTM C1199 |
| Glazing Array | Argon-Filled Triple-Pane Insulated Tempered Glass | 6mm Low-E + 12Ar + 6mm + 12Ar + 6mm Laminated Security Glass | EN 1279 / ASTM E2190 |
| Drainage Outlets | Multi-tiered Pressure Equalized Cascading System | Max Rain Handling Capacity: 380mm/hr; Zero siphon backflow | AAMA 501.1 / ASTM E331 |
| Acoustic Isolation | EPDM Multi-point Gasketing Co-extrusion | Acoustic Decibel Mitigation: STC 42 - 45 dB | ISO 10140 / ASTM E90 |
| Wind Pressure | Internal Mechanical Reinforced Corner Joints | Resistance rating ≥ Class 8 (up to 5.0 kPa pressure deflection) | GB/T 7106 / ASTM E330 |
Our development roadmap is centered around deep physical science. By integrating seamless micro-welding at key frame connections, we eliminate structural gaps where air infiltration occurs. This is supplemented by high-density corner-injection glue lines that boost joint load limits by 40% compared to typical screw-fastened models.
Furthermore, our Munihei Series utilizes an integrated roof-gutter profiles layout. Rather than relying on external aftermarket plastic gutters, our heavy-duty primary rafters also act as structural rain channels, redirecting torrential runoff away from seal joints, preventing water infiltration even during heavy storms.

We use architectural-grade 6063-T6 or high-strength 6063-T66 aluminum profiles. This ensures a tensile strength of ≥ 205 MPa, providing the rigidity needed for tall spans without relying on intermediate support beams.
Our sunrooms feature multi-cavity polyamide thermal break strips (PA66-GF25). These strips separate the interior and exterior aluminum frames, reducing heat transfer and allowing the system to achieve low U-factors below 1.5 W/m²K when combined with low-emissivity double or triple glazing.
Yes. Every sunroom configuration is analyzed using Finite Element Method (FEM) software to model local wind and snow loads. Our structural frames are rated to handle wind pressures of up to 5.0 kPa and snow loads up to 1.5 kN/m².
Standard custom orders take between 30 and 45 days after engineering drawings are approved and deposits are received. This includes extrusion, CNC machining, finishing, and pre-assembly testing.
We design our primary rafters with built-in internal water channels. Rainwater flows through these channels into pressure-equalized paths within the vertical columns, preventing water build-up and leaks during storms.
Yes. Our systems are built and tested to meet ASTM, CE, and CSA requirements. Our factory operates under ISO 9001, ISO 14001, and ISO 45001 standards, and we verify glazing and weatherproofing performance through independent third-party laboratories.
We use heavy-duty plywood crates with foam interleaving and vacuum-sealed plastic wrap. This protects the aluminum profiles and glass units from moisture and physical impact during sea transit.
